车牌识别相机二次开发所需要的那些协议—专业篇&通俗易懂篇 - 教程
车牌识别相机二次开发都需要哪些协议?

专业篇
网络传输与通信协议
HTTP 协议(HyperText Transfer Protocol)
应用层协议,用于浏览器和服务器之间传输网页、JSON 等数据。
在相机里常用于配置管理、图片上传/下载、API调用。
TCP 协议(Transmission Control Protocol)
传输层协议,保证数据可靠、有序、无丢失。
相机与后台平台之间的数据传输(如识别结果推送)往往基于 TCP。
RS485 协议
一种工业总线的物理层/数据链路层标准,不是网络协议。
常用于门禁、道闸等低速控制信号的通信。车牌相机可通过 RS485 直接控制道闸。
视频/安防行业协议
GB/T 1400 协议
一般是指国内停车行业常见的车牌识别通信协议标准(不同厂家完成可能有差异)。
用于停车场管理系统与相机对接,统一数据格式。
GB28181 协议
中国国家标准《安全防范视频监控联网系统信息传输、交换、控制技术要求》。
主要用于视频监控联网,公安/住建等平台规定必须协助。
相机可通过该协议接入公安视频监控平台。
Onvif 协议
国际视频监控标准协议(开放网络视频接口论坛)。
主要用于不同厂家的摄像机与 NVR/DVR 视频平台互通。
支持发现设备、获取视频流、远程控制。
RTSP 协议(Real Time Streaming Protocol)
实时流媒体传输协议,用于传输音视频流。
相机输出实时视频给监控客户端/NVR,通常是
rtsp://ip:554/xxx。
数据上传/推送协议
FTP 协议(File Transfer Protocol)
文件传输协议,用于将抓拍图片上传到服务器。
传统方式,很多老停车场管理系统还在用。
MQTT 协议(Message Queuing Telemetry Transport)
轻量级消息发布/订阅协议,常用于物联网。
相机识别结果可作为消息推送到 MQTT Broker,方便云平台处理。
WebSocket 协议
基于 TCP 的全双工通信协议,适合实时数据交互。
相机可依据 WebSocket 将车牌识别结果实时推送给浏览器或应用。
总结
HTTP、TCP、WebSocket、MQTT→ 偏通用网络数据通信。
RTSP、Onvif、GB28181→ 偏视频监控领域。
RS485、GAT 1400→ 偏停车场/门禁控制行业。
FTP→ 偏传统文件传输。
也就是说,易泊车牌识别相机支持这么多协议,意味着它既能对接老式停车场控制器(RS485/FTP),又能接公安监控平台(GB28181/Onvif/RTSP),还能接入云端物联网系统(HTTP/MQTT/WebSocket),兼容性和扩展性很强。
通俗易懂篇
网络通用的“语言”
HTTP
就像浏览器上网用的“语言”,相机依据它把图片、识别结果传给后台,就像手机 App 请求天气数据一样。TCP
相当于“顺丰快递”,每个包裹(数据)都按顺序、完整送到,绝不丢件。很多协议(HTTP、WebSocket)都要靠它来保证传输。WebSocket
就像开了一条“实时热线”,相机和后台能随时互相说话,不用每次都打电话再挂掉。专门适合实时推送识别结果。MQTT
这是物联网常用的“微信群”,相机往群里发一条“车来了”的消息,所有订阅的体系都能看到。
视频监控的“行业习惯”
RTSP
相机的视频直播通道,就像打开一个“直播间”,监控软件/NVR 一连上就能实时看画面。Onvif
相当于“行业通用接口”,不管你是什么牌子的摄像机,只要说该语言,就能被录像机/监控平台识别、控制。GB28181
这是国家标准的“普通话”,公安、政府监控平台规定所有摄像机必须会说这种话,才能接入他们的系统。
停车场/门禁专用的“方言”
RS485
一种老牌的“串口语言”,常用来直接控制道闸、卷帘门,车一来,相机经过 RS485 发个“开门”的信号。GAT 1400
停车行业里的一种“统一说法”,方便停车场管理系统和相机互通,不同厂家也能对接。
文件传输的老方式
FTP
就像老式的“快递柜”,相机把抓拍的图片存进去,后台系统定时去取。现在用得少,但很多旧架构还需要。
总结一句话
HTTP/TCP/WebSocket/MQTT→ 相机和后台聊天的方式。
RTSP/Onvif/GB28181→ 相机给人看视频的方式。
RS485/GAT1400→ 相机跟道闸、停车系统打交道的方式。
FTP→ 老办法存取图片的方式。

浙公网安备 33010602011771号